Default Best tents made

If you are looking for great tents look at Davis Tents. www.davistents.com. We use there stuff exclusively in Montana and Idaho and they are top quality, will last for years and years and hold heat quite well and at a reasonable price. I purchase 3 tents per camp one for guides, one for clients and one for cooking and eating and these tents are some of the best in the industry, especially in heavy snow.
